Vehicle Preparation Checklist: Cleaning, Inspection and Small Repairs Before Selling

Vehicle Preparation Checklist: Cleaning, Inspection and Small Repairs Before Selling

Preparing your vehicle before listing it can improve the photos, reduce unnecessary questions and help buyers see that it has been cared for. The goal is not to make an older vehicle look new. It is to present it honestly, identify obvious problems and decide which small repairs are worth completing before the first viewing.

Clean the exterior

Wash the body, wheels, windows and mirrors. Remove dirt from around the license plates, lights, door handles and wheel arches.

Check for faded trim, loose badges, cracked lights and small areas of surface dirt that may look like damage. Avoid heavy cosmetic changes that could make buyers wonder whether you are hiding previous repairs. A clean, natural presentation is usually more convincing than excessive polishing.

Prepare the interior

Remove personal belongings from the seats, floor, door pockets, cup holders, glove compartment and cargo area. Vacuum the carpets and seats, wipe the dashboard and clean the inside of the windows.

Pay attention to odors. Damp carpets, smoke or strong air fresheners can make buyers concerned about leaks or hidden smells. If the interior has a known stain, tear or damaged panel, clean it as well as possible and show it honestly in the listing.

Complete a basic inspection

Walk around the vehicle and check that the headlights, brake lights, indicators, reverse lights and wipers work. Look at the tires for low pressure, uneven wear, cracking or very little tread. Check the spare tire and confirm that the jack and wheel tools are present.

Under the hood, check for visible leaks, loose connections and damaged hoses. Make sure the engine oil, coolant, brake fluid and windshield-washer fluid are at suitable levels. Do not ignore warning lights on the dashboard. If one remains on after startup, find out what it means before advertising the vehicle.

Consider worthwhile small repairs

Simple repairs can improve a buyer’s first impression without requiring a large investment. Replacing blown bulbs, worn wiper blades, missing valve caps, damaged floor mats or an inexpensive piece of trim may be worthwhile.

Ask a mechanic for an estimate before approving larger work. Expensive paint repairs, major bodywork or mechanical replacements may not add enough value to recover their cost. In some cases, it is better to adjust the asking price and disclose the problem clearly.

Get ready for photos and viewings

After cleaning and checking the vehicle, remove cleaning supplies and park it in a bright, uncluttered location. Take clear photos of the exterior, interior, dashboard, seats, cargo area, engine bay and any visible damage.

Keep maintenance receipts and repair records available for serious buyers. Be ready to explain what you repaired, what still needs attention and whether the price reflects those issues. Honest preparation helps build trust and can prevent surprises during an inspection or test drive.

Final pre-sale checklist

Before publishing on MyBelize Autos, confirm that you have:

  • Located the ownership and registration documents.
  • Recorded the correct VIN, mileage, engine size and key specifications.
  • Removed personal belongings from the interior and cargo area.
  • Cleaned the exterior, interior, wheels and windows.
  • Checked the tires, lights, fluid levels, brakes, battery and warning lights.
  • Completed worthwhile maintenance or minor repairs.
  • Confirmed the vehicle’s current insurance, registration and license status.
  • Taken clear photos showing the vehicle’s condition and any visible damage.
  • Prepared an accurate listing that includes known problems as well as useful features.

A clean vehicle, a few sensible repairs and a clear description can make the listing more useful without creating unrealistic expectations.
